Currently, two REITs and InvITs each are listed on the exchanges —Embassy Parks REIT and Mindspace Business Parks REIT, and IRB InvIT Fund and India Grid Trust in InvIT.

Raghavendra Kamath Mumbai
The Budget proposal allowing debt financing by foreign portfolio investors (FPIs) in real estate investment trusts (REITs) and infrastructure investment trusts (InvITs) and exempting taxes on dividends will lead to more listings by such investment vehicles, said top executives and capital market experts. This could even prompt smaller players to opt for the instruments, they said.
